Understanding the Emotional Aspect

The emotional aspect of losing your virginity is often the most significant. It's natural to feel nervous, anxious, and even scared before having sex for the first time. It's important to remember that everyone's experience is different, and there's no right or wrong way to feel. Some people may feel excited and eager, while others may feel hesitant and unsure. It's essential to communicate with your partner and ensure that both of you are comfortable and ready to take this step.

Building Trust and Communication

Before having sex for the first time, it's crucial to build trust and open communication with your partner. Trusting your partner and feeling comfortable with them is essential for a positive sexual experience. It's essential to talk openly about your feelings, desires, and any concerns you may have. This open dialogue can help alleviate anxiety and ensure that both partners are on the same page.

Taking Things Slowly

It's important to take things slowly when it comes to first-time sex. Rushing into things can lead to discomfort and even pain. It's essential to be patient and explore each other's bodies at a pace that feels comfortable for both partners. Taking your time can help build intimacy and create a more meaningful experience.

Understanding Consent

Consent is a crucial aspect of any sexual encounter, especially when it comes to first-time sex. Both partners should feel comfortable and willing to engage in sexual activity. It's essential to have open and honest conversations about consent and ensure that both partners are on the same page. If at any point either partner feels uncomfortable or unsure, it's important to stop and reassess the situation.

Physical Preparation

Physically preparing for first-time sex is essential for a positive experience. It's important to ensure that both partners are educated about safe sex practices and have access to protection, such as condoms. It's also crucial to be mindful of your body's natural responses, such as arousal and lubrication, and to communicate openly about any discomfort or pain.

The Aftermath

After having sex for the first time, it's natural to experience a range of emotions. Some people may feel a sense of relief or accomplishment, while others may feel more vulnerable and exposed. It's essential to check in with your partner and communicate about how you both are feeling. It's also important to practice self-care and be kind to yourself as you process this new experience.

In conclusion, losing your virginity is a significant moment in anyone's life. It's essential to approach this experience with sensitivity, open communication, and a focus on mutual respect and consent. By taking things slowly, building trust with your partner, and being prepared both emotionally and physically, you can make your first-time sex a positive and memorable experience. Remember, everyone's experience is different, and it's important to honor your own feelings and desires as you navigate this new chapter in your life.
